Here in Toronto despite practically 15-18% drop of crude price in one week gas is still costs practically same. They dropped just $0.03-0.04. Does it say that big guys know something? Otherwise how to explain why prices are not going down at the pump?
May be because the gasoline made of oi; bought at higher prices for now?

Oh the official explanation may sound like that yeah but in reality it's just extra profit for the petrol company. Nobody forces them to follow crude prices up and down and they're aware of that. Crude goes up - next day you see it at the pump. Crude collapses - no hurry to cut the prices.
